Just Listen: Discover the Secret to Getting Through to Absolutely Anyone
Making someone understand you is both a skill and an art.
There are times when things can get worse if you can't break through emotional barriers and get your message across.
This book by Mark Goulston is about how to make the people in your life who are "impossible" and "unreachable" into allies, loyal customers, long-term friends, and business partners. Goulston has worked as a psychiatrist, a business consultant, and a coach.
How: Just Listen shows you how to:
Do everything you can to make a strong and good first impression.
It's important to listen well.
Talk an angry or aggressive person out of a bad reaction and into a better one.
You must get people to agree with you in order to be able to persuade them, negotiate, or sell them something.
Coworkers, friends, family, or complete strangers are all people you can get to listen to you. The first step to convincing anyone to do anything is to get them to listen to what you have to say. This book on active listening will give you the tools you need to do just that.
You're Not Listening: What You're Missing and Why It Matters
We live in a world where social media always tells us to start the conversation and share our own stories.
As a side note, though, it doesn't seem like there's enough emphasis on actually listening to people.
Then, it's making us less tolerant than we have ever been.
There is a book called You're Not Listening by Kate Murphy, who is a New York Times contributor and a listener by trade. She talks about why we're not listening, what it's doing to us, and how we can stop it.
Her book talks about the psychology, neuroscience, and sociology of listening, as well as some of the best listeners in the world. She also introduces us to the CIA agent, focus group moderator, bartender, radio producer, and top furniture salesman.
Overall, Murphy gives a heartfelt, passionate, and insightful view of society. He also gives a rousing call-to-action to help readers make positive changes on a personal level.

Power Listening: Mastering the Most Critical Business Skill of All
Listening is more difficult than it looks, but it can make or break your business.
In Power Listening, Bernard Ferrari, a top executive adviser, talks about how poor listening can make people make bad decisions in organizations. He also shows how good listening habits can be learned and practiced.
Here are some of his most important ideas about how to be a good listener:
A hard job, not a simple one
It means asking questions, questioning all assumptions, and understanding the context of every interaction you have with someone.
It gives you a new sense of focus, more efficiency, and a better chance of making better decisions.
Can make the difference between a long and short job.
To turn a "tin ear" into one with platinum ears, you'll learn how to ask thoughtful questions, affirm your conversation partner, and show that you're truly present while reading this book.
